On 4/5/07, Davanum Srinivas <[EMAIL PROTECTED]> wrote:

Yep. that's the simplest deployment scenario where you have just one
service (or set of services). just drop your wsdl and services.xml in
WEB-INF and your classes in WEB-INF/classes
